Time Quote by Chris Carter

“Our knowledge does not help us to forecast the future, but it makes us more certain that our guesses are the right ones. In other words, it makes us opinionated and lets us believe that we know and makes us feel more confident – without making our predictions more accurate.” quote by Chris Carter
